(Read the full article...)When my son Nicholas was born, we noticed several purplish patches on the left side of his face. Initially we thought they might be bruises from the birth process, but when they didn't fade we discovered that they were a type of birthmark called hemangioma. These birthmarks have garnered a wide variety of responses over the years. When he was a baby we would get dirty looks from people who apparently thought we were harming him. Then when he was a toddler, most folks assumed that he had just taken a fall. As he got older and people asked, we had him explain that the marks were there because too many angels had kissed him on his way down from heaven.
